How Reliable is the Daewoo Tacuma?

Based on 100,978 MOT tests across 9,200 vehicles.

70.6%
Pass Rate
6,041
Miles/Year
26
Year Lifespan
9,200
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Brake pipe excessively corroded 11,796
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 6,096
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 3,910
Registration plate lamp not working 2,630
brake binding 2,281

KA04 YXR is a 2004 Daewoo Tacuma in Silver with a 1,998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 61.5%.

Across all 2004 Daewoo Tacuma models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.7% with a typical mileage of 51,034 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Daewoo Tacuma f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 11,796 recorded failures. If you're considering buying KA04 YXR,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Daewoo Tacuma typ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 22 years old, this Daewoo Tacuma is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
